Job Description
AI Engineer at WeAssist focusing on workflow automation and AI-driven systems to optimize business processes. Collaborate globally to build intelligent solutions that impact various industries.
Responsibilities:
- Design, implement, and optimize automations using tools like n8n, Make.com, and Zapier
- Build reliable integrations across Microsoft 365, Google Workspace, Slack/Teams, WhatsApp, CRMs, and more
- Ensure automations are error-resilient, scalable, and proactively monitored with smart error handling and notifications
- Develop AI-driven workflows such as transcription pipelines, chatbots, meeting assistants, and voice-to-form solutions
- Leverage APIs like OpenAI, Claude, ElevenLabs, and Read AI to deliver intelligent user experiences
- Fine-tune, prompt, and optimize large language models (LLMs) for task-specific use cases (e.g., summarization, classification, Q&A)
- Create and maintain data dashboards and automated reporting pipelines using AirTable, Google Data Studio, HubSpot, and Sheets/Excel
- Deploy and manage AI models in production environments with continuous monitoring and performance tuning
- Partner with stakeholders to understand needs, map workflows, and translate requirements into technical solutions
- Document workflows, integrations, and automations to ensure transparency, scalability, and easy maintenance
Requirements:
- 2+ years of experience with workflow automation platforms (n8n, Make.com, Zapier, Power Automate)
- Strong knowledge of API integration principles (REST, OAuth 2.0, webhooks, JSON)
- Experience automating across tools like Microsoft 365, Google Workspace, Slack/Teams, and CRMs.
- Familiarity with AI/LLM APIs (OpenAI, Claude, ElevenLabs, transcription/voice tools)
- Strong analytical and troubleshooting skills, with a proactive approach to reliability
- Excellent communication skills to explain technical concepts clearly to non-technical stakeholders
- Strong organizational skills and ability to map and optimize workflows end-to-end.
